Paleo Spinach Crepes
- 2 Tablespoons Palm Shortening Or Cooking Fat Of Choice
- 13 cups Tapioca Flour
- 1/4 cups Coconut Flour
- 1 Tablespoon Psyllium Husk Powder
- 1 teaspoon Baking Powder
- 1/2 teaspoons Onion Powder
- 1/2 teaspoons Garlic Powder
- 1/2 teaspoons Salt
- 2 cups Fresh Baby Spinach
- 1 cup Egg Whites (or Whites From 12 Large Eggs)
- 1/2 cups Water
- 2 Tablespoons Apple Cider Vinegar
- 1 Tablespoon Honey Or Sweetener Of Choice
- Preheat frying pan on low heat.
- Melt palm shortening and set aside.
- Add all dry ingredients except spinach to blender; blend on high speed for 20-30 seconds to sift and combine dry ingredients thoroughly.
- Empty into large mixing bowl and set aside.
- Add all wet ingredients to blender, including the spinach, and blend on high until smooth and well mixed.
- Add dry ingredients back in and blend until well incorporated with wet ingredients.
- Dip your pastry brush in the liquid fat and brush a thin coating all over your frying pan, coat it thoroughly, and dont skip around the edges.
- The oil will go very far when you spread it thinly.
- Using a ladle or spoon, pour about 1/4 cup of the batter into the greased frying pan and swirl it around to spread it out in the pan until its the size you want (6 rounds are recommended).
- Try not to stretch it too thin or it might tear or cook unevenly.
- Cook until lightly browned and firm on one side, gently flip over and cook other side until also lightly browned and firm.
- After each crepe, remove it from the pan onto a plate and brush with cooking fat before each ladle goes in.
- I dont recommend cooking more than one at a time unless you use a large griddle.
- Repeat until all batter is used.
- Notes: Dont be alarmed when batter thickens the longer it sits.
- Quickly spread it out in pan to avoid uneven cooking.
- I highly recommend using these as savory crepes, lasagna noodles, manicotti shells, Mexican casseroles, or as a sandwich wrap!
